Top Birds at Crown Heights, Brooklyn in May
relative to other locations within 25 miles of 40.781243, -73.966507

based on 39 checklists

This page shows the probability of a species appearing on a checklist at Crown Heights, Brooklyn in May. The difference in probability relative to other nearby locations is also shown, to highlight which birds are particularly likely to be found (or not found) at this specific location.
